Sarbati Sella Basmati Rice
Specifications:
Origin: India
Average Grain Length (AGL): 6.90 mm to 7.10 mm (Standard)
Length (Elite Grade): Up to 7.20 mm+
L/B Ratio: ~3.5 to 4.0
Moisture Content: 12.5% – 13% Max
Purity: 95% Min
Broken Grains: 1% – 2% Max (Sortex Cleaned)
Damaged/Discoloured: 1% Max
Cooked Elongation: 1.8x to 2.0x
General Physical Description:
- Grain Type: Long Slender.
- Colour: Creamy white (Creamy Sella) or Amber/Golden (Golden Sella).
- Shape: Long and thin, though slightly less “curved” than traditional Basmati.
- Aroma: Mild, sweet, and pleasant; it has a noticeable fragrance but is less intense than the 1121 or Traditional varieties.
- Texture: Firm and non-sticky. The parboiling process ensures that even if slightly overcooked, the grains do not turn into a paste.
